Kickstart your NED career

Starting 28th of April: Ideal if you are exploring NED roles for the first time - to help you develop your strategy, prepare for your first applications and understand the landscape of opportunities available to you.
✦︎ MONTH 1

Finding your Focus

What does success looks like for you? This session is designed to help you establish a clear and focused strategy, ensuring your efforts are aligned with your ambitions.
28th of April | 5 pm to 6 pm BST
✦︎ MONTH 2

Building your Board CV

Your boardroom profile is your calling card - it’s how you capture attention and demonstrate the value you can bring as a non-executive candidate.
19th of May | 5 pm to 6 pm BST
✦︎ MONTH 3

Honing Your Elevator Pitch

Develop and refine your elevator pitch to confidently introduce yourself as a board-ready candidate. Practise delivering your pitch and receive constructive feedback to build impact and confidence.
30th of June | 5 pm to 6 pm BST
✦︎ MONTH 4

Networking with Purpose

Discover the importance of strategic networking and create a plan to build meaningful connections. Learn how to identify key events, individuals, and opportunities that align with your board aspirations.
28th of July | 5 pm to 6 pm BST
✦︎ MONTH 5

Mastering Applications

Master the art of applying for board roles with tailored cover letters and CVs. Learn best practices to craft impactful applications that showcase your fit and value for the roles you pursue.
1st of September | 5 pm to 6 pm BST
✦︎ MONTH 6

Nailing Interviews

Prepare for NED interviews with confidence. Learn how to present yourself effectively, conduct due diligence, and handle rejection with resilience. Conclude the programme with mock interviews and a reflective review of your progress.
29th of September | 5 pm to 6 pm BST

Developing your NED career

Starting 29th of April: Perfect if you have one or two board roles, and are ready to build the knowledge and network needed for more competitive paid board roles or a Chair position.
✦︎ MONTH 1

Clarifying ambitions

Refine your boardroom strategy by defining target roles, balancing paid and not-for-profit opportunities, and understanding the benefits and challenges of a portfolio career.
29th of April | 5 pm to 6 pm BST
✦︎ MONTH 2

Refining your Board CV and Profile

Hone your Board CV, LinkedIn profile, and Nurole presence to effectively highlight your expertise, align with your ambitions, and stand out in the competitive landscape.
27th of May | 5 pm to 6 pm BST

✦︎ MONTH 3

Networking for growth

Build a strategic networking plan that includes navigating the headhunter landscape and connecting with influential individuals to open doors to paid and senior roles.
24th of June | 5 pm to 6 pm BST
✦︎ MONTH 4

Preparing for chair roles

Gain insights from serving Chairs on how to transition effectively, key considerations before stepping up, and what it takes to excel as a Chair.
29th of July | 5 pm to 6 pm BST
✦︎ MONTH 5

Mastering Applications

Learn advanced techniques to craft standout applications, including tailored cover letters and CVs, that position you for senior and Chair roles.
2nd of September | 5 pm to 6 pm BST
✦︎ MONTH 6

Sharpen Your Interview Skills

Develop strategies for excelling in interviews for Chair and senior NED roles, conduct robust due diligence, and plan your next steps to continue advancing your portfolio career.
30th of September | 5 pm to 6 pm BST
